Theresa turned 63 years old. Jeffersonville, Canton, Louisville and one other city are cities Theresa has lived in. Theresa is related to or closely associated with Terry L Rector, Paul T Rector, Terry L Rectorsr and 6 other people. The birth year was listed as 1961. The number currently linked to Theresa is (812) 288-9788. The residency of Theresa is at 3129 Eastbrook Blvd, Jeffersonvlle, In 47130.